SharePoint Server에서 콘텐츠 데이터베이스 추가Add content databases in SharePoint Server

요약: SharePoint Server 2016 및 SharePoint 2013 팜에 콘텐츠 데이터베이스를 추가하는 방법을 설명합니다.Summary: Learn how to add a content database to your SharePoint Server 2016 and SharePoint 2013 farm.

SharePoint 중앙 관리 웹 사이트 또는 Microsoft PowerShell을 사용하여 SharePoint Server 팜에 콘텐츠 데이터베이스를 추가할 수 있습니다. 배포한 환경의 종류, 일정 요구 사항 및 조직과의 서비스 수준 계약에 따라 사용하는 도구가 달라집니다.You can add a content database to a SharePoint Server farm by using the SharePoint Central Administration website or Microsoft PowerShell. The tool that you use depends on the kind of environment that you have deployed, your schedule requirements, and service level agreements that you have made with your organization.

시작하기 전에Before you begin

새 콘텐츠 데이터베이스를 추가하거나 백업 파일에서 기존 콘텐츠 데이터베이스를 연결할 수 있습니다.You can add a new content database or attach an existing content database from a backup file.

이 작업을 시작하기 전에 필수 구성 요소와 관련한 다음 정보를 검토하십시오.Before you begin this operation, review the following information about prerequisites:

  • 이 작업을 수행하는 사용자 계정은 Farm Administrators SharePoint 그룹 구성원이어야 합니다.The user account that is performing this operation must be a member of the Farm Administrators SharePoint group.

  • Windows 인증을 사용하여 SQL Server에 연결하는 경우 사용자 계정은 데이터베이스를 만들 SQL Server 인스턴스에서 dbcreator 고정 서버 역할의 구성원이어야 합니다.If you use Windows authentication to connect to SQL Server, the user account must be a member of the dbcreator fixed server role on the SQL Server instance where the database is to be created.

SharePoint Server 웹 응용 프로그램에 콘텐츠 데이터베이스 추가Adding a content database to a SharePoint Server web application

이 문서에서 설명하는 절차를 수행하여 새 콘텐츠 데이터베이스를 만든 다음 웹 응용 프로그램에 연결할 수 있습니다. Windows 인증을 사용하여 SQL Server에 연결하는 경우에는 사용자 계정이 데이터베이스를 만들 SQL Server 인스턴스에 대한 SQL Server dbcreator 고정 서버 역할의 구성원이기도 해야 합니다. SQL 인증을 사용하여 SQL Server에 연결하는 경우에는 콘텐츠 데이터베이스를 만들 때 지정하는 SQL 인증 계정에 데이터베이스를 만들 SQL Server 인스턴스에 대한 dbcreator 권한이 있어야 합니다.You can use the procedures that are described in this article to create a new content database and attach it to a web application. If you are using Windows authentication to connect to SQL Server, the user account must also be a member the SQL Server dbcreator fixed server role on the SQL Server instance where the database will be created. If you are using SQL authentication to connect to SQL Server, the SQL authentication account that you specify when you create the content database must have dbcreator permission on the SQL Server instance where the database will be created.

중앙 관리를 사용하여 웹 응용 프로그램에 콘텐츠 데이터베이스를 추가하려면To add a content database to a web application by using Central Administration

  1. 이 작업을 수행하는 사용자 계정이 Farm Administrators SharePoint 그룹의 구성원인지 확인합니다.Verify that the user account that is performing this operation is a member of the Farm Administrators SharePoint group.

  2. 중앙 관리를 시작합니다.Start Central Administration.

  3. SharePoint 중앙 관리 웹 사이트에서 응용 프로그램 관리를 클릭합니다.On the SharePoint Central Administration website, click Application Management.

  4. 데이터베이스 섹션에서 콘텐츠 데이터베이스 관리를 클릭합니다.In the Databases section, click Manage content databases.

  5. 콘텐츠 데이터베이스 관리 페이지에서 콘텐츠 데이터베이스 추가를 클릭합니다.On the Manage Content Databases page, click Add a content database.

  6. 콘텐츠 데이터베이스 추가 페이지에서 다음을 수행합니다.On the Add Content Database page:

    • 새 데이터베이스의 웹 응용 프로그램을 지정합니다.Specify a web application for the new database.

    • 새 데이터베이스를 호스팅할 데이터베이스 서버를 지정합니다.Specify a database server to host the new database.

    • 새 데이터베이스에서 사용할 인증 방법을 지정하고, 필요한 경우 계정 이름과 암호를 입력합니다.Specify the authentication method that the new database will use and supply an account name and password, if they are necessary.

      중요

      계정 이름과 암호는 SQL Server 로그인으로 이미 있어야 합니다.The account name and password must already exist as a SQL Server login.

    • 장애 조치(failover) 데이터베이스 서버의 이름을 지정합니다(있는 경우).Specify the name of the failover database server, if one exists.

    • 경고 발생 이전에 만들 수 있는 최상위 사이트의 수를 지정합니다. 기본값은 2,000입니다.Specify the number of top-level sites that can be created before a warning is issued. By default, this is 2,000.

    • 데이터베이스에서 만들 수 있는 최상위 사이트의 전체 수를 지정합니다. 기본값은 5,000입니다.Specify the total number of top-level sites that can be created in the database. By default, this is 5,000.

  7. 확인을 클릭합니다.Click OK.

PowerShell을 사용하여 웹 응용 프로그램에 콘텐츠 데이터베이스를 추가하려면To add a content database to a web application by using PowerShell

  1. 다음 멤버 자격이 있는지 확인합니다.Verify that you have the following memberships:

    • SQL Server 인스턴스에 대한 securityadmin 고정 서버 역할securityadmin fixed server role on the SQL Server instance.

    • 업데이트하려는 모든 데이터베이스에 대한 db_owner 고정 데이터베이스 역할db_owner fixed database role on all databases that are to be updated.

    • PowerShell cmdlet을 실행 중인 서버의 Administrators 그룹Administrators group on the server on which you are running the PowerShell cmdlets.

      관리자는 Add-SPShellAdmin cmdlet을 사용하여 SharePoint Server cmdlet 사용 권한을 부여할 수 있습니다.An administrator can use the Add-SPShellAdmin cmdlet to grant permissions to use SharePoint Server cmdlets.

      참고

      권한이 없는 경우 설치 관리자 또는 SQL Server 관리자에게 문의하여 권한을 요청하십시오. PowerShell 권한에 대한 자세한 내용은 Add-SPShellAdmin을 참조하십시오.If you do not have permissions, contact your Setup administrator or SQL Server administrator to request permissions. For additional information about PowerShell permissions, see Add-SPShellAdmin.

  2. SharePoint 관리 셸를 엽니다.Open SharePoint Management Shell.

  3. PowerShell 명령 프롬프트에 다음 명령을 입력합니다.At the PowerShell command prompt, type the following command:

    New-SPContentDatabase -Name <ContentDbName> -WebApplication <WebApplicationName>
    

    여기서 각 부분이 나타내는 의미는 다음과 같습니다.Where:

    • <ContentDbName> 은 만들 콘텐츠 데이터베이스의 이름입니다.<ContentDbName> is the name of the content database to create.

    • <WebApplicationName> 은 새 데이터베이스를 연결할 웹 응용 프로그램의 이름입니다.<WebApplicationName> is the name of the web application to which the new database is attached.

자세한 내용은 New-SPContentDatabase를 참조하십시오.For more information, see New-SPContentDatabase.

참고

기존 콘텐츠 데이터베이스를 웹 응용 프로그램에 연결하려면 Microsoft PowerShell cmdlet Mount-SPContentDatabase를 사용하세요. 자세한 내용은 Mount-SPContentDatabase를 참조하세요.To attach an existing content database to a web application, use the Microsoft PowerShell cmdlet Mount-SPContentDatabase. For more information, see Mount-SPContentDatabase.

참고

명령줄 관리 작업을 수행하는 경우 Windows PowerShell을 사용하는 것이 좋습니다. Stsadm 명령줄 도구는 더 이상 사용되지 않지만 이전 제품 버전과의 호환성을 지원하기 위해 포함됩니다.We recommend that you use Microsoft PowerShell when performing command-line administrative tasks. The Stsadm command-line tool has been deprecated, but is included to support compatibility with previous product versions.

참고 항목See also

개념Concepts

SharePoint Server에서 콘텐츠 데이터베이스 연결 또는 분리Attach or detach content databases in SharePoint Server

SharePoint Server에서 데이터베이스 간에 사이트 모음 이동Move site collections between databases in SharePoint Server